You can look a Sagrin ratings to get a pretty good idea of where the line will fall. It’s not usually that far off from the line, especially as we get later in the season.

Based on Sagarin, Auburn is about 1 point better than Ole Miss and 2 points better than A&M. Alabama is about 10 points better than us. Adjust for homefield advantage, and as of today it would suggest that the spread would be -4 against Ole Miss, +1 at A&M, and +7 against Bama.

I think that sounds about right. We are all rightfully nervous about the Ole Miss offense, but they barely beat Arkansas and Tennessee. They have plenty of flaws to exploit at home coming off an extra week of prep.
